Buying Guide for 2 Inch Floor Transition

Understanding What a 2 Inch Floor Transition Is

When I first looked into floor transitions, I realized that a 2 inch floor transition is a narrow strip used to bridge the gap between two different types or heights of flooring. It helps create a smooth and visually appealing connection, preventing tripping hazards and protecting the edges of the floors.

Why Size Matters: The Importance of the 2 Inch Width

I found that the 2 inch width is ideal for smaller gaps or when a discreet transition is needed. It provides enough coverage without overwhelming the space, making it perfect for tight areas or subtle design preferences. Choosing the right width helps ensure a seamless look and proper functionality.

Material Options and Their Benefits

From my experience, floor transitions come in various materials such as wood, metal, vinyl, and rubber. Each material offers different durability and aesthetic qualities. For example, wood blends well with hardwood floors, while metal is more durable for high-traffic areas. I always consider the existing flooring and room conditions before selecting a material.

Installation Considerations

I learned that some 2 inch floor transitions are easier to install than others. Some require adhesives, while others snap into place or screw down. It’s important to assess your DIY skills and the tools you have before purchasing. Also, knowing the height difference between floors helps determine if additional underlayments are necessary.

Matching Style and Color

I paid attention to the style and color of the transition to ensure it complements both flooring types. Neutral colors and simple designs tend to blend well, but you can also choose a contrasting finish for a decorative effect. Matching the transition to your overall interior style enhances the room’s appearance.

Durability and Maintenance

In my experience, selecting a durable floor transition means less worry about wear and tear, especially in busy areas. Materials like metal or high-quality vinyl are easier to clean and maintain. I also check if the transition is resistant to moisture and scratches, depending on the room’s environment.

Budget and Cost Factors

I found that prices for 2 inch floor transitions vary based on material, brand, and installation method. Setting a budget helped me narrow down options without compromising quality. Remember to factor in any additional costs such as installation tools or professional help.
